Georges Rouault's 'Head of Christ' embodies profound spiritual contemplation through its stark black contours framing luminous blue hues—a testament to his distinctive stained-glass inspired style and enduring empathy for humanity’s suffering.
Georges Rouault’s "Bouquet II" (1929-1939) captures the poignant beauty of still life—a vase overflowing with crimson roses against a muted canvas, reflecting Rouault's signature dark contours framing luminous color fields. Explore this masterpiece at The Phillips Collection.
